Output 98368084d96b556015c6ec03a818c01a36544295550769e340d2a467bb59712c:14
- value
- 75688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e4feae1e07c411ada56395433e10bbd27a0dd15 OP_EQUAL
- address
- 3QshJ2xWgFH24GwAT4dCXHsQrViQpbA5pv
- transaction
- 98368084d96b556015c6ec03a818c01a36544295550769e340d2a467bb59712c
- confirmations
- 92753
- spent
- true